Four Military Vets Vie in GOP Primary for Key Virginia Tidewater District to Oust Democrat
Virginia’s Congressional District 2 (CD 2) spans Williamsburg, Virginia Beach, parts of Norfolk, and traces the northern reaches of Naval Station Norfolk, the world’s largest naval base. Judge Orders GOP Candidate for Governor to Surrender Guns
Michigan Republican candidate for governor Ryan Kelley will have to surrender his guns while he is awaiting trial on misdemeanor criminal charges in connection to the Jan. 6 U.S. Capitol breach, according to a judge’s ruling issued Thursday. Hillary Clinton Reveals Whether She’ll Run for President in 2024
Former Secretary of State Hillary Clinton detailed whether or not she might run for president in 2024 amid speculation about President Joe Biden’s future. The 2016 Democratic presidential nominee told the Financial Times that she’s not considering making another presidential bid, saying that she expects Biden to run for reelection.
